Schematics showing the cell exposure procedure for chronic and nonchronic samples. (A) Chronic cell samples were plated, and NPs/media (0.1 nM NPs) were added after 24 h. NP/media solutions were changed 3 d later, and cells were passaged after an additional 3 d to start a new cycle. (B) Nonchronic cell samples were plated and NPs/media (0.1 nM NPs) were added after 24 h. NP/media was changed to just media after another 24 h. Media was refreshed 2 d later, and another 3 d later, the cells were passaged. (C) After the first week, the nonchronic subsequent passage cycles followed the chronic sample schedule, with no NPs added. Controls followed same schedule, with no NPs ever added.
